This all-season house is located on Keene Valleys Johns Brook Road a mile from the village and quarter of a mile below the Garden, one of the two main trail heads in the high peaks region. The site is a particular boon when the Garden parking lot is full and hikers have to use the satellite lot. The house adjoins the original "Marcy Outlook", where guests at Interbrook Lodge came for after dinner walks to "say goodnight to Marcy" The core of the house is a living room with a large stone firepla …ce and a kitchen/dining area. Both open onto a large deck with a picnic table and Adirondack chairs. The living room picture window frames a view of Marcy, as does the picture window in the master bedroom. Beyond the kitchen/dining area are three bedrooms and a laundry/storage room (washer and dryer). A separate wing, reached through the entry hall behind the living room, is a large master bedroom with its own fireplace. There is an excellent stereo sound system. The house sleeps seven, and all but one bedroom have mountain views. Twin beds in three of the rooms can be converted to king upon request. There are one and a half baths. (The half bath is not winterized.) Begun in 1950 and expanded in later years by Landon (Rocky) Rockwell, an avid mountaineer, it continues to be used by family as well as offered for rentals. The books, paintings and photos in the camp reflect the original owner's lifetime of mountaineering. Audible below the house, John's Brook can be reached by a climb down the bank. The nearby village of Keene Valley offers great food, a renowned mountaineering store, an excellent hardware store, a wonderful library (with wifi) and a beautiful village church which often hosts concerts. The village now has cell phone coverage which reaches the house on a somewhat spotty basis; Verizon Mifi connection is similarly available.

About Us: We have been coming to the Adirondacks since the cabin was built in 1950 by Landon ("Rocky") Rockwell, an avid mountaineer who hiked in the Adirondacks, the White Mountains, the Canadian Rockies and the Swiss Alps and trekked in Tibet and Nepal. The "we" now stretches to a fourth generation. Recent renters spent their evenings in front of the fire reading Rocky's "Along the Way", tales of his mountain adventures. Most renters enjoy stepping into the history reflected in the cabin.
